BILL NUMBER: S3625
SPONSOR: OBERACKER
 
TITLE OF BILL:
An act to amend the tax law, in relation to extending the authorization
for imposition of additional sales tax in the county of Schoharie
 
PURPOSE:
To authorize the Schoharie County Board of Supervisors to impose an
additional one percent sales tax for a two-year period.
 
SUMMARY OF PROVISIONS:
Section one amends section 1210 of the tax law to extend the authori-
zation for Schoharie County to impose an additional one percent (1%)
sales tax until November 30, 2027.
Section two provides the effective date.
 
EXISTING LAW:
The law expires on December 1, 2025.
 
JUSTIFICATION:
This legislation needs to be renewed in 2025 so that the county can
continue to collect the additional tax without interruption. Requested
by the Schoharie County Board of Supervisors (Res. No. 21).
 
LEGISLATIVE HISTORY:
The law was previously extended by Chapter 61 of the laws of 2017 in an
omnibus measure (A.40001).
 
FISCAL IMPLICATIONS:
None to the state
 
EFFECTIVE DATE:
Immediate
